communicative

adjective

com·​mu·​ni·​ca·​tive kə-ˈmyü-nə-ˌkā-tiv How to pronounce communicative (audio) -ni-kə-tiv How to pronounce communicative (audio)
1
: tending to communicate : talkative
2
: of or relating to communication
communicatively adverb
communicativeness noun
